Re: Side rail cover??
The rail cover is a OEM dealer part dude, its comes as 3 pieces - the cover - and new rail itself - and a mounting clip. To be honest i only ordered the cover and bonded it which is 100% and not going anywhere, only cost £27 squid.
Someone will post up the part number no doubt
